The Benefits Of Outplacement Support Services

In today’s ever-changing job market, companies and organizations are constantly looking for ways to stay competitive and innovative. One way that many businesses are choosing to do this is by offering outplacement support services to their employees. outplacement support services are designed to help individuals who are experiencing job loss transition to new employment as smoothly as possible.

outplacement support services can include a variety of resources and tools, such as career counseling, resume writing assistance, job search training, interview preparation, networking opportunities, and more. These services are typically provided by professional career coaches and counselors who have the expertise and experience to guide individuals through the job search process.

One of the key benefits of outplacement support services is that they can help individuals navigate the often daunting and overwhelming task of finding a new job. Job loss can be a traumatic experience, and having access to outplacement support services can make a significant difference in how quickly and successfully someone is able to find new employment.

outplacement support services can also help individuals identify their skills and strengths, explore new career opportunities, and set realistic career goals. Career coaches can provide valuable feedback and insight into a person’s job search strategy, helping them to stand out in a competitive job market.

Another important benefit of outplacement support services is that they can help individuals maintain a positive attitude and outlook during the job search process. Job loss can be a major blow to a person’s self-esteem and confidence, but with the support and encouragement of a career coach, individuals can stay motivated and focused on their job search goals.

Furthermore, outplacement support services can help individuals develop new skills and knowledge that can enhance their employability. Whether it’s learning how to use social media for networking, improving their interview skills, or updating their resume, individuals can gain valuable insights and tools that can help them succeed in their job search.

Employers who offer outplacement support services to employees who are being laid off can also benefit from the program. Providing outplacement support services demonstrates a commitment to employee well-being and can help to maintain a positive employer brand. It can also help to reduce the negative impact of layoffs on remaining employees, as they see that their employer is invested in helping their former colleagues find new opportunities.
